Which of the following models for assigning values to options takes into account the volatility of stock prices?
The Black-Scholes, binomial models, and lattice models are option-pricing models that take into account the volatility of stock prices when measuring the fair value of options. The calculated value method is only available to nonpublic companies that cannot estimate volatility.

Purchase and sale of treasury stock, journal entry
This answer is incorrect. When treasury stock is acquired using the cost method, a stockholders’ equity account is debited for the cost of the treasury stock.
Treasury stock xxx
Cash xxx
When the treasury stock is subsequently sold for cash at more than its acquisition price, additional paid-in capital is credited for the gain.
Cash xxx
Treasury stock xxx
APIC treasury stock xxx
Thus, the purchase would not affect additional paid-in capital but, the sale would increase it.
How would the declaration of a 10% stock dividend by a corporation affect each of the following on its books?
Retained earnings (RE) Total stockholders’ equity (SE)
Decrease No effect
This answer is correct. Regardless of the size of a stock dividend, RE is decreased and other SE accounts are increased. Since the dividend described in this question is small (< 20-25% of the outstanding shares), the journal entry would be
Retained earnings (FV)
Common stock dividend distributable (par value)
Additional paid-in capital (plug)
Accordingly, RE will decrease and, since all affected accounts are elements of SE, total SE will not change. Note that the entry for a large stock dividend would be
Retained earnings (par) Common stock dividend distributable (par)

Normally, dividends are not paid on shares which have not been issued. However, an entity can choose to pay dividend equivalents on options. How are these dividend equivalents accounted for on options which vest, and how are they accounted for on options which do not vest?
Vest Not vest
Compensation expense Compensation expense
Compensation expense Charge against retained earnings
Charge against retained earnings Compensation expense
Dividends or dividend equivalents on options which vest are to be accounted for as other dividends—that is, charged against retained earnings—but those paid on options which do not vest are deemed to be compensation expense.
